The new press is impressive in size. Its height is 4,7 meters and its weight is 650 tons. The equipment is capable of creating a pressure of 40 megapascals, so that all large-sized parts for fuselages can be immediately put into production.
The machine received the index P5220. It was created by order from the United Aircraft Company (UAC). They need to increase production volumes of domestic MS-21 and Tu-214 airliners as quickly as possible.
And now they have this opportunity. The press has already been tested - it is capable of stamping a wide range of long fuselage parts and not only them. If necessary, P5220 can be used for the manufacture, for example, of fuel tanks and various aircraft panels.
The press is a 100% Russian development. This means that it was possible to produce it without the use of foreign components. In the future, this will help organize the production of similar equipment, adapted not only for parts of the MS-21 and Tu-214 fuselages, but also for other models. The main advantage of the P5220 machine is the speed of production of elements. One part takes a maximum of 2 minutes.
The unique Russian press is fully automated. This is a modern machine with software.
The equipment guarantees precision in the manufacture of parts. The engineers, when creating the P5220, were aware that the machine was intended for aviation, and there the slightest miscalculation could lead to disaster.
